    Lemon cake

    Ingredients

    225g unsalted butter, softened

    225g caster sugar

    4 eggs

    finely grated zest 1 lemon

    225g self-raising flour

    For the drizzle topping

    juice 1.5 lemons

    85g caster sugar

    Directions

    Take a deep bowl; whisk the eggs together with the sugar, followed by the slightly melted butter, lemon zest, and, finally, the flour. Stir thoroughly to combine everything. Tip the mix into the greased tin paper. Bake at 180C/fan 160C/gas 4 for 50 minutes until baked through.

    Meanwhile, make the sprinkle topping by mixing together the necessary ingredients. Once the cake is done, leave it to cool a little. Then tap in some places and sprinkle over the lemony sugar. Serve with a cup of tea, if you wish.
